John Wilson
John Wilson is president of the Corporate Real Estate Services and Office Brokerage Divisions of HSA Commercial Real Estate, as well as president of HSA PrimeCare, HSA’s health care real estate consulting services group. He leads a group of talented brokers specializing in corporate services, office brokerage and healthcare real estate consulting.
Experience
Having been in the industry for more than 20 years, Wilson is one of Chicago’s most respected commercial real estate leaders. He has been successful in all aspects of the industry, including tenant representation, property marketing, real estate development, land transactions and owner representation. Wilson has negotiated hundreds of lease transactions valued in excess of $1 billion on behalf of a variety of prominent tenants and landlords. Some of those clients include The Federal Reserve Bank of Chicago, Kemper Financial Services, Honeywell and Bank of America.
In 1995, Wilson initiated a healthcare real estate advisory initiative which has grown into a separate operating division of HSA called PrimeCare. Wilson has led the growth of this group, which serves clients such as Good Samaritan Hospital, Christ Medical Center, Lutheran General Hospital, Provena St. Joseph, Provena St. Mary’s South Suburban Hospital, and M & M Orthopaedics, to name a few. The group has also developed and purchased nine medical office buildings across the nation totaling more than 500,000 square feet in size.
Wilson began his career in 1976 and was a top grossing broker by age 25 He co-founded Irvine Associates (later renamed Realsource, Inc.) and developed the company into one of the largest real estate firms in the Midwest.

Timothy Stanton
Timothy Stanton is executive vice president in the Corporate Real Estate Services and Office Brokerage Divisions of HSA Commercial Real Estate and is responsible for serving corporate clients and spearheading the growth of the division.
Experience
Stanton has represented clients in more than 200 cities throughout the United States, and has represented the Carlson Companies since 1992. Their well known brands include such companies as Carlson Wagonlit Travel, Radisson & Regent Hotels, Country Inns & Suites and TGI Fridays. In the past two years, he has completed 20 transactions in 16 cities for Carlson, most notably representing Carlson Marketing Worldwide in the renegotiation of its Automotive Division World headquarters in Troy, Mich., the negotiation of a lease renewal in San Antonio, Texas for Carlson Wagonlits Government Division headquarters; and, the consolidation of Carlson Travel Operations in St. Louis, Mo. after the acquisition of Maritz Travel.
In addition to his work with corporate clients, Stanton is part of a three-person team that developed the PrimeCare Division at HSA, with real estate services geared specifically toward the health care industry. He has been responsible for the portfolio management for Advocate Health and Hospital Corporation, as well as a member of the development and leasing teams at HSA PrimeCare, responsible for nine medical office buildings totaling close to 500,000 square feet throughout the Midwest.
Prior to joining HSA, Stanton served as senior vice president for The Prime Group Realty Services.

Robert L. Titzer
Robert L. Titzer is an executive vice president in HSA Commercial Real Estate's Corporate Real Estate Services and Office Brokerage Divisions and brings a broad background of commercial real estate experience to his client's assignments.
Experience
Titzer has a thorough understanding of the transaction process, including a strong background in construction, financial analysis, lease negotiation and an excellent knowledge of the national accounts service process. He has fostered long-standing relationships with clients such as Waste Management Incorporated, Storage Technology Incorporated, Advocate Healthcare, and the University of Chicago Hospitals. He has expanded the firm's business with national clients by handling all of the company's transaction assignments for leading national technology and information system companies in national markets. Titzer assisted in the development of the "Realsource Network" of service providers in other markets in the US and abroad. Most recently, he directed transaction services growth in the healthcare sector.
Prior to joining HSA, Titzer worked for The Prime Group Realty Services since 1988. He was also a development manager for a Chicago area developer/landlord. His experience on the landlord's side of the lease-negotiating table has made him a valuable asset to his clients in-tenant representation work. Titzer also designed mechanical systems for high-rise office buildings, including several Chicago skyscrapers while at Skidmore Owings and Merrill.

Jon E. Boley
Jon E. Boley is an assistant vice president of acquisitions and development for HSA PrimeCare. He is responsible for sourcing, underwriting and closing medical facility developments and acquisitions, as well as providing market, financial and risk analysis, asset evaluations and related economic modeling for retail and office transactions.
Experience
Since joining HSA in 2005, Boley has performed numerous market and financial feasibility studies for healthcare organizations, including a market assessment for a $32 million bond financing for the Illinois Medical District. He is currently underwriting more than $40 million in medical office developments and acquisitions for HSA.
Prior to joining HSA, Boley served as senior analyst at Klaff Realty LP in Chicago where he underwrote large portfolio transactions including Service Merchandise and Mervyn’s, valued at more than $1.4 billion. He was also an analyst at Economics Research Associations, where he performed market and financial feasibility analysis for retail, office, and healthcare nationally.
